Veterinarians in Spring, TX
Veterinarians
11530 Northwest Frwy At Antoine.,
Spring ,
TX
77373
UNITED STATES
Based on 1 reviews
Excellent!
Been going to Dr. Upton for 15+ years. Very tenative , informative, honest. I won't go anywhere else. Isn't quick to diagnose or do surgery just because... I have sent many friends to him over the years, especially for second opinions...Worldwide > United States > Spring, TX > Veterinarians